One of the few comforts liberals had in the aftermath of the election was the anecdotal reporting that fake-news purveyors found it easier to get conservatives to believe their baloney.
As one such fake-news entrepreneur, responsible for articles with headlines like, FBI Agent Suspected in Hillary Email Leaks Found Dead in Apparent Murder-Suicide, told NPR: "Weve tried to do [fake news with] liberals. It just has never worked, it never takes off. You'll get debunked within the first two comments and then the whole thing just kind of fizzles out."
No doubt this served as a signal, to some, that if fake news works better on Trump supporters, it must be because liberals are smarter than conservatives. I can safely binge-drink the next four years away, some liberals might have thought, since I have all these extra brain cells to burn.
Well, not quite. According to a study slated to be published in the journal Psychological Science, it might be true that conservatives are more likely to fall for false, threatening-seeming information, but its not because theyre dumb. Its because theyre hyper-attuned to hazards in their world. If they spot a sign of danger, they figure trusting it is better than ignoring it.
